Understanding Epstein Barr Virus
Epstein Barr virus (EBV), also known as human herpesvirus 4, is a common viral infection that affects millions of people worldwide. It is a member of the herpes family of viruses and is primarily transmitted through saliva, commonly known as the “kissing disease.”
EBV can cause infectious mononucleosis, also known as mono, which is characterized by symptoms such as fever, fatigue, sore throat, swollen lymph nodes, and enlarged spleen. While most people recover from mono without complications, the virus can remain in the body and reactivate later in life, leading to various health challenges.

Home Remedies for Epstein Barr Virus
If you’re looking for natural solutions to manage Epstein Barr virus symptoms, there are simple and effective home remedies that can provide relief and support your body’s healing process. These remedies aim to alleviate symptoms, boost your immune system, and aid in your overall recovery.
1. Stay Hydrated
Proper hydration is crucial for supporting your immune system and aiding in the healing process. Drink plenty of water throughout the day to stay hydrated and help flush out toxins.
2. Get Plenty of Rest
Rest is essential for your body to recover from Epstein Barr virus. Make sure you get enough sleep and take adequate rest breaks throughout the day to support your immune system and promote healing.
3. Warm Saltwater Gargles
Gargling warm saltwater can help soothe a sore throat and relieve inflammation caused by Epstein Barr virus. Mix half a teaspoon of salt in a cup of warm water, gargle, and then spit it out. Repeat several times a day for relief.
4. Herbal Teas
Herbal teas, such as chamomile tea and ginger tea, can provide relief from symptoms and support your immune system. These teas have calming and anti-inflammatory properties that can help alleviate discomfort and promote healing.
5. Steam Inhalation
Steam inhalation can help relieve congestion and ease respiratory symptoms caused by Epstein Barr virus. Fill a bowl with hot water, place a towel over your head to create a tent, and inhale the steam for a few minutes. Be cautious to avoid burns.
6. Nutrient-Rich Foods
Eating a diet rich in nutrients can support your immune system and aid in the recovery process. Include foods high in vitamins C, E, and D, as well as zinc and selenium, to help strengthen your body’s defenses against Epstein Barr virus.
7. Warm Compresses
Applying warm compresses to areas of discomfort, such as swollen lymph nodes, can help reduce inflammation and provide relief. Use a clean cloth soaked in warm water and gently apply it to the affected area for several minutes.
